The ferry from Savona to Golfo Aranci connects the Italian mainland with the Italian island of
Sardinia. The route is offered by the shipping company
Corsica Ferries. The journey time is about 18 hours.
Golfo Aranci
Golfo Aranci is a small town on the north-east coast of Sardinia, around 14 km north-east of Olbia. It is mainly characterized by tourism and is known for its numerous beaches that stretch around the town.
The ferry port Golfo Aranci connects the island of Sardinia with the ports of Piombino and Livorno on the Italian mainland and with France. A total of 6 routes are offered here several times a day by the shipping company Corsica Ferries.
